School of Management Sciences Scholarships and Funding

Babu Nageshwar Singh Scholarship is offered to postgraduate students:

The scheme will be applicable to the undergraduate students (BBA, BCA & B.Tech. programs) of SMS for pursuing Post-Graduate courses at SMS, Lucknow/ Varanasi

1. Students achieving less than 70% of marks in BBA/ BCA/ B.Tech courses at SMS will get a scholarship of 15% of First-Year Fee in MBA slab courses run at SMS.
2. Students achieving 70% and above marks in BBA/ BCA/ B.Tech courses at SMS will get a scholarship of 20% of First-Year Fee in MBA courses run at SMS.

Prof. Mukund Lal Scholarship (for Year Toppers):
SMS have system of providing adequate scholarship towards toppers of each year of various graduate and post-graduate programmes.

School of Management Sciences Varanasi, popularly known as SMS Varanasi, was established in 1995. Located in Varanasi, Uttar Pradesh, SMS Varanasi is a private institute. It is a UGC-recognised institute and has also been granted autonomous status by the UGC.

One branch of SMS is also in Lucknow.
